Buffalo Bills Position of Need: Wide Receiver

The Buffalo Bills are well set at the top of the depth chart with Stefon Diggs and Gabriel Diggs but after these two is where the questions start to arise. Cole Beasley is entering the final year of his contract and is someone that could be cut or asked to restructure his contract this offseason.

The Bills also have Emmanuel Sanders and Isaiah McKenzie set to be free agents and it remains to be seen if one or both are back.

The wide receiver position is not like the defensive end position where they need a top receiver but instead need to find a player to address a specific need for this offense. That need is a player who can rack up yards after the catch and pressure opposing defenses downfield with great speed.

This past season, Buffalo finished last in the NFL in yards after the catch with an average of only 4.2 yards. The focus is going to be on finding that speedy wide receiver that can make big plays down the field and this is something that may come in the NFL Draft.
